    i submit to tgps every day. i don't get rich, but i average around $2500 - $3000 a month income from posting and it takes a total of 3 hours a day to make galleries and post them. when i was more motivated, i did around $5000 but i've had so many things going on...

    i believe that like tv or radio, we can make money will giving away free content. consider this: a guy who wants to see full length muscle man movies is still going to buy rather than surf a zillion tgps to see mostly 15 pic galleries and no movies.

    the problem is that there is a certain mindset to making galleries and that kind of marketing is foreign to people who work other kinds of marketing. most people i work with are overwhelmed (hi, bec!) when i really critique their gallery with an eye to explaining this kind of marketing.

    as far as owning tgps, i gave it up. it was a lot of work, actually. and didn't make anywhere approaching what my avs sites or my galleries or the paysites make. it can be fun, though :-)
